To assist you in troubleshooting your issue, I recommend performing a Syscheck on your Wii. This involves testing all the IOS on your console. Here's a step-by-step guide you can follow: https://wii.guide/syscheck

  • Once you complete the Syscheck, power down the Wii and insert the SD or USB into a PC. it will have generated a syscheck.csv file on the ROOT of your device.

  • To share the results with me, simply drag and drop the syscheck.csv file from the root directory of your SD or USB drive into the chat. This will allow us to analyze the information and provide further assistance.

  • You can also upload the report by linking the URL to chat or take photos of the entire report if you don’t have a USB or a SD reader on your PC.

Is the sd card FAT32 with the partition style MBR and a 32kb cluster size and put the lock in the up position

1. I recommend you use the Windows program, ModMii. It has many Wii modding tools or "activities" built in.

ℹ️ Check your SD/USB for a WAD folder. If you have it, please delete it before continuing.

Download and install ModMii to your windows PC
https://modmii.github.io/

Launch Modmii Classic (not ModMii Skin)
Type I Agree and press enter
Type SU and press enter to select the Syscheck Updater Activity.
Provide it the syscheck.csv file you just made by dragging the syscheck.csv file from the root of your SD/USB and dropping it into the ModMii window.
It might ask you if you want to remove\overwrite RiiConnect24 in IOS 31. You can say no.
It'll list many wad files that it will download, select Y = Yes. Type O to Open File Location "COPY_TO_SD"
Copy the contents of the COPY_TO_SD folder to the root of your SD. Follow the generated guide that opened in your web browser closely.

ℹ️ Don't forget to install the stub files in root:/wad/stubs/ after you install the other wad files.

2. Make a new syscheck and post it after you complete step 1.
